We have an office shredder. Why should we outsource our shredding?

Outsourcing your shredding services to The Shredder MedShred guarantees secure, compliant disposal while saving time, saving money and reducing risk.

 Smaller office shredders will only shred a few sheets of paper at a time. With more and more paper needing to be shredded, this method is time consuming. In an office, employee productivity is very important. An already overburdened employee uses valuable time shredding paper when they should be focusing on core tasks. This is expensive and demoralizing. Ironically, the smaller the office is, the bigger impact on productivity. This can lead employees to by-pass the shredding process so that much of what should be destroyed is simply discarded. This can lead to increased risk for businesses large and small.

 By using The Shredder + MedShred security collection equipment, provided at no cost, compliance is easy. Materials that require shredding are simply deposited and forgotten. On a preset schedule, developed and customized to your needs, The Shredder + MedShred will collect and secure destroy all sensitive or confidential information.

Why hire a shredding company?

Hiring a secure shredding company is the most effective way to ensure all confidential or sensitive material is destroyed. Security collection containers provided by The Shredder protects materials from people who have no need to see it. Shredded material from in office shredders is typically discarded in normal waste streams where bad actors can use software to scan and recreate shredded materials. Hiring The Shredder ensures that all materials destroyed are mixed with thousands of pounds of additional shredded material, baled and sent for recycling in a secure process making it impossible for documents to be recreated.

What is the National Association for Information Destruction (NAID) and what does it mean to be NAID Certified?

NAID is a non-profit trade association that sets the standards and best practices for the information destruction industry. NAID is well-known for its certification, which is sough after by businesses when partnering with document destruction companies. NAID certification is a program for companies that provide destruction services to help businesses verify that a shredding company meets strict information disposal standards established by the National Association of Information Destruction. NAID verifies through scheduled and random audits throughout the year that shredding companies maintain strict compliance and best practices to ensure regulatory due diligence obligations. Noncompliance will result in a company losing their NAID certification.

What is the importance of secure document shredding?

Secure document shredding protects sensitive information from unauthorized access and identity theft, ensuring compliance with privacy laws.

Does your machine shred everything?

Staples, fasteners, and paper clips are also shredded, so there’s no need to take them out. Different materials do require different destruction methods, therefore we do ask that paper products be collected separately from hard drives or medical waste, etc. This ensures we can properly destroy each type of waste. We recycle our sensitive information, is that good enough?

Recycling is insufficient to meet regulator compliance. Most recycling companies do not screen their employees or restrict employment to those of known criminals and access at recycling companies is typical not restricted. Recycling does not provide a Certificate of Destruction for your material.

What receipts are safe to throw away? Which should you shred?

Feel free to contact us for our recommended document retention schedules showing how long you should keep records before safely destroying them. Shred all receipts containing sensitive information such as your name, address, credit card number, or any other identifiable details. Here is a list of important documents and receipts that should be shredded to protect your personal and sensitive information:

  • Bank Statements – Contains sensitive financial information that can be used for identity theft.
  • Credit Card Statements and Receipts – Prevent unauthorized access to your credit card details.
  • Tax Documents – Includes personal identification information and financial records.
  • Medical Records and Bills – Protects your private health information and prevents medical identity theft.
  • Pay Stubs – Contains sensitive employment and financial information.
  • Utility Bills – Prevents unauthorized access to your address and account details.
  • Insurance Policies and Claims – Protects your personal and policy information from falling into the wrong hands.
  • Investment Documents – Includes sensitive information about your investment accounts.
  • Old Identification Documents – Such as expired passports, driver’s licenses, and social security cards.

Loan Documents – Prevents exposure of your personal and financial loan details

What goes into smaller collection containers vs. larger collection containers?

Smaller collection containers are used for items like needles and syringes, while larger containers can handle bulkier waste. Loose sharps should never be dumped into larger containers without proper containment.

What documentation am I required to keep for my records?

You are required to keep documentation that includes proof of compliant disposal, typically provided through a Manifest or a Certificate of Destruction. This documentation is crucial for regulatory compliance and audits. We will provide you with these documents and if you happen to misplace them, we keep copies for you.
